California is leading a sweeping change in industrial fleet operations with the rollout of the zero emission forklift mandate enforced by the California Air Resources Board (CARB). Beginning January 1, 2026, businesses across warehousing, distribution, and manufacturing will be required to phase out most internal combustion (IC) forklifts in favor of electric or zero-emission alternatives.
